Sports betting

Whether or not sports betting is gambling is a debate that is ongoing. Some claim it’s not gambling, and others claim it’s a pure form of gambling. Regardless of how you look at it, there are a few things you need to know.

First, you have to understand what sports betting is. Sports betting involves making bets on the outcome of sporting events. This could involve betting on the winner, the exact score, or even whether the team will win or lose.

Online gaming

Whether you want to gamble online or offline, you will need to know your local laws. In some cases, gambling is legal while in others it is illegal. Whether you want to bet on a sport, play poker or play casino games, it is important to know the laws of your state before committing yourself to a gambling activity.

Currently, the United States has not imposed any kind of federal law governing online gambling. But several US states have put robust regulations on online gambling sites.
